DIY or Hire a Pro? Deciding on Your Roofing Project

When it comes to home improvement, roofing projects often present a significant dilemma. Should you roll up your sleeves and tackle it yourself, or is it best to hire a seasoned professional? This decision isn’t always straightforward, and getting it wrong can have costly implications. This blog post will guide you through the factors to consider when deciding between a DIY roofing project and hiring a pro. You’ll learn about the pros and cons of each approach, safety considerations, cost implications, and more.

Evaluating Your Skill Level

Assessing your skill level is crucial when deciding whether to DIY or hire a pro. Are you comfortable working at heights? Do you have experience with power tools? Basic carpentry skills and familiarity with roofing materials are necessary for a successful DIY project. If you lack experience, you might find yourself overwhelmed quickly. On the other hand, hiring a pro can ease this burden, ensuring the job is done right the first time.

Safety Considerations

Roofing can be hazardous. Falls are one of the most common injuries associated with roofing projects. Professionals are trained to handle these risks, using safety harnesses, guardrails, and other protective measures. If you decide to DIY, investing in safety equipment and adhering to safety guidelines is non-negotiable. Your safety should always be the top priority, regardless of your choice.

Time Commitment

A professional roofing team can complete a project in a fraction of the time it might take an amateur. They have the manpower, tools, and experience to work efficiently. For a DIY project, you’ll need to consider the time you can realistically commit. Roofing is labor-intensive and time-consuming, often requiring several weekends or even longer. Balancing this with your daily responsibilities can be challenging.

Cost Implications

One of the main reasons homeowners consider a DIY approach is cost savings. Hiring a professional can be expensive, with costs varying based on the roofing material, labor, and the project’s complexity. However, DIY isn’t free. You’ll need to purchase materials, rent or buy tools, and potentially spend more if mistakes occur. Weighing these costs against hiring a pro can help determine the best financial decision.

Quality of Workmanship

The quality of your finished roof can vary significantly between DIY and professional work. Professionals bring a level of craftsmanship honed through years of experience. While you may be capable of tackling the project yourself, it’s essential to consider the potential for mistakes and their impact on your roof’s longevity.

Material Selection

Choosing the right materials for your roof is critical. Professionals have access to a wider range of materials and can recommend the best options based on your climate, budget, and aesthetic preferences. If you’re DIY-ing, you’ll need to research extensively to ensure you’re picking suitable materials. Incorrect choices can lead to higher maintenance costs and a shorter lifespan for your roof.

Warranty and Insurance

Professional roofing companies often provide warranties for their work, offering peace of mind that any future issues will be addressed without additional cost. They also carry insurance, protecting you from liability in case of accidents. A DIY project lacks these safety nets. If something goes wrong, the cost falls squarely on your shoulders, and fixing mistakes can be more expensive than hiring a pro initially.

Seeking Expert Advice

If you’re still unsure, consulting with a roofing expert can provide valuable insights. Many professionals offer initial consultations for free or at a minimal cost. They can assess your roof’s condition, offer recommendations, and give you a clearer picture of what the project entails. This advice can be invaluable in making an informed decision.

Comparing Quotes

If you lean towards hiring a pro, obtaining multiple quotes is essential. Different contractors offer varying levels of service, warranties, and pricing. Comparing these aspects can help you find the best value for your money and ensure you are making an informed decision. Additionally, be sure to check reviews and ask for references to gauge the quality of work and customer satisfaction. Even if you decide on a DIY approach, understanding professional costs can set a benchmark for your budget and give you a clearer idea of what to expect in terms of time and resource investment. Taking these steps will ultimately lead to a more successful and satisfying project outcome.

DIY or Hire a Pro? Deciding on Your Roofing Project

Deciding between a DIY roofing project and hiring a professional is a significant choice that depends on various factors, including your skill level, safety concerns, time commitment, and financial implications. While a DIY project can be rewarding, it comes with risks and challenges. Hiring a pro ensures quality, safety, and peace of mind, although at a higher cost. Ultimately, the best decision is one that aligns with your abilities, resources, and priorities.
